Stability in open strings with broken supersymmetry

Presented by Dr. Hervé PARTOUCHE on 1 Jul 2019 from 14:50 to 15:10
Type: oral presentation
Track: String Theory and Alternatives

Content

We construct type I string models where supersymmetry is spontaneously broken, which have exponentially small cosmological constant and are tachyon free at 1-loop. These theories have rigid Wilson lines associated with stacked branes. Models with positive effective potentials of runaway type are also presented.
